James Garner has picked former Manchester City midfielder Ilkay Gundogan as the most difficult opponent he has faced.

After seven years at Manchester United, the German signed for Barcelona as a free agent during the previous summer transfer window.

After leading City to a historic Treble, Gundogan has been referenced by a current Premier League player who was unable to prevent Pep Guardiola’s side from winning the league title last season.

Garner said Gundogan is the most difficult opponent he has faced.

In a Tik Tok video on Everton’s channel, Garner revealed his thoughts on the toughest opponent he has faced.

He stated: “Gundogan last year. I just couldn’t get near him, and he ended up with two goals and an assist.”

Looking back at the 3-0 win over the Toffees that Garner is referring to, Gundogan only got 43 touches of the ball in the 78 minutes he was on the field yet had such a huge impact on the outcome.

This performance earned the midfielder a solid match rating of 8.9/10 from SofaScore, making him the highest-rated player on the day, and it’s easy to see why Garner now says Gundogan was the toughest opponent he’s ever faced.

Later, the German international demonstrated his importance to the Citizens by scoring both goals in their 2-1 FA Cup final victory over Manchester United.

Since joining Barcelona, the 33-year-old has scored five goals and provided six assists in 25 La Liga outings, demonstrating his value as a midfielder.
